Bio Protocol announced the launch of Long COVID Labs on January 9. The project aims to accelerate the cure of Long COVID with decentralized science (DeSci).

Long COVID Labs Vision

Long COVID Labs aims to tackle challenges left by COVID-19. The project claims that 20% of recovered patients still have viral remnants, including spike proteins, in their bloodstream. 40% of those diagnosed with Long COVID suffer from chronic illness. Long COVID Labs aims to cure Long COVID, unlock treatments for billions, and redefine the future of medicine.

Project Founders

The founders of the project include: Rohan Dixit, healthcare entrepreneur and former neuroscientist at Stanford; Ruth Ann Crystal (MD), Stanford physician entrepreneur; Jacob Glenville, Centivax founder; Annelise Barron, Stanford bioengineering professor.

Largest Decentralized Clinical Trial Network

The project claims to be the largest decentralized clinical trial network, using machine learning to identify patterns, optimize trials, and suggest individualized treatments. Long COVID Labs aims to shift the focus from investors to patients.

Long COVID Labs presents a new model of involvement with governance tokens held by patients to influence research and financial outcomes. BIO Protocol was announced as the 63rd project on Binance Launchpool.
